Handle Your Karma, Don't Dump It
by John-Roger

I'd rather you hit me physically than hit me with the karma that you release that you won't handle. People that I work closely with know that I pick up a lot of things, and maybe 90 percent of them I can deal with spiritually. The rest has to walk around with me because I'm here doing this seminar. I'm the target of your attention. Where you focus your attention, your beingness is going to generate, and when your beingness comes back off again, I'm going to keep holding the karma that you produced and gave out to me.

If you would do spiritual exercises, if you would meditate, if you would contemplate, if you would pray, you could have handled all of that and not dumped anything on me.

I could sit here and say, "It's very strange. I come to you loving, and you come to me in loving -- and you dump on me. Why don't you come to me in loving and have it clean and clear and let me walk out the same way? Is that unreasonable?"

You might say, "Well, but J-R, you're this and you're that, and you do this and…"

So what? Just because you're good at a computer and a word processor, does that mean you get everything dumped on you all day long? You say, "No."

Well, it means the same thing for me.
